Subject: Re: [PATCH] pinctrl: mediatek: fix a memleak when do dt maps.



On 17/11/15 09:25, Daniel Kurtz wrote:
> On Tue, Nov 17, 2015 at 12:22 PM, Hongzhou Yang
> <hongzhou.yang@...iatek.com> wrote:
>> configs will kmemdup to dup_configs in pictrl util function.
>> So configs need to be freed.

>>   drivers/pinctrl/mediatek/pinctrl-mtk-common.c |   24 ++++++++++++++----------
>>   1 file changed, 14 insertions(+), 10 deletions(-)
>>
>> diff --git a/drivers/pinctrl/mediatek/pinctrl-mtk-common.c b/drivers/pinctrl/mediatek/pinctrl-mtk-common.c
>> index bbf0230..0f9e416 100644
>> --- a/drivers/pinctrl/mediatek/pinctrl-mtk-common.c
>> +++ b/drivers/pinctrl/mediatek/pinctrl-mtk-common.c
>> @@ -520,21 +520,23 @@ static int mtk_pctrl_dt_subnode_to_map(struct pinctrl_dev *pctldev,
>>          if (has_config && num_pins >= 1)
>>                  maps_per_pin++;
>>
>> -       if (!num_pins || !maps_per_pin)
>> -               return -EINVAL;
>> +       if (!num_pins || !maps_per_pin) {
>> +               err = -EINVAL;
>> +               goto exit;
>> +       }
>>
>>          reserve = num_pins * maps_per_pin;
>>
>>          err = pinctrl_utils_reserve_map(pctldev, map,
>>                          reserved_maps, num_maps, reserve);
>>          if (err < 0)
>> -               goto fail;
>> +               goto exit;
>>
>>          for (i = 0; i < num_pins; i++) {
>>                  err = of_property_read_u32_index(node, "pinmux",
>>                                  i, &pinfunc);
>>                  if (err)
>> -                       goto fail;
>> +                       goto exit;
>>
>>                  pin = MTK_GET_PIN_NO(pinfunc);
>>                  func = MTK_GET_PIN_FUNC(pinfunc);
>> @@ -543,20 +545,21 @@ static int mtk_pctrl_dt_subnode_to_map(struct pinctrl_dev *pctldev,
>>                                  func >= ARRAY_SIZE(mtk_gpio_functions)) {
>>                          dev_err(pctl->dev, "invalid pins value.\n");
>>                          err = -EINVAL;
>> -                       goto fail;
>> +                       goto exit;
>>                  }
>>
>>                  grp = mtk_pctrl_find_group_by_pin(pctl, pin);
>>                  if (!grp) {
>>                          dev_err(pctl->dev, "unable to match pin %d to group\n",
>>                                          pin);
>> -                       return -EINVAL;
>> +                       err = -EINVAL;
>> +                       goto exit;
>>                  }
>>
>>                  err = mtk_pctrl_dt_node_to_map_func(pctl, pin, func, grp, map,
>>                                  reserved_maps, num_maps);
>>                  if (err < 0)
>> -                       goto fail;
>> +                       goto exit;
>>
>>                  if (has_config) {
>>                          err = pinctrl_utils_add_map_configs(pctldev, map,
>> @@ -564,13 +567,14 @@ static int mtk_pctrl_dt_subnode_to_map(struct pinctrl_dev *pctldev,
>>                                          configs, num_configs,
>>                                          PIN_MAP_TYPE_CONFIGS_GROUP);
>>                          if (err < 0)
>> -                               goto fail;
>> +                               goto exit;
>>                  }
>>          }
>>
>> -       return 0;
>> +       err = 0;
>>
>> -fail:
>> +exit:
>> +       kfree(configs);
>>          return err;
>>   }
